Staxio vs Asana for managing external creator work

Asana is built for the team inside your studio — sprints, internal tasks, dependencies, workload. When you try to use it to receive work from outside creators, you hit the same walls every time: no file preview, no contributor portal, no submission state, no way for an external to participate without a paid seat.

Why studios switch from Asana

Externals don't need a paid seat

Asana's guest model is limited — externals can collaborate, but every active reviewer/contributor pulls you toward a higher plan. Staxio prices on roster, not on guests: external creators interact through a free portal, no seat fee.

Files render, not link out

Asana tasks let you attach a file. The preview is limited to PDF, image, and video, and most studios end up linking out to Drive/Dropbox anyway. Staxio renders 20+ formats inline — 3D, PSD, ZIP, code, audio — so reviewers actually decide in-context.

A submission ≠ a task

In Asana, you'd need a "task" per submission, with comments scattered, a fragile attachment, and an approval-state custom field. Staxio's submission object bundles files, versions, comments, approval state, contributor identity, and audit log natively — it's the right shape for incoming work.

Honest take

When Asana is the better choice

We're not the answer for every use case. Here's where Asana wins outright.

  • You're managing internal team work — sprints, task dependencies, internal milestones.
  • You need timeline / Gantt / workload views to plan team capacity.
  • Your "external collaborators" are actually freelance designers/devs working inside your sprint cadence as guest team members, not creators submitting finished work.
